Biography
“No!” Diath turned and began to storm out.
“What? Why?” Sonnet demanded.
Calysta stopped him and softly asked why he would not allow Qen admittance to the clan.
Trying not to shout at his mate he simply said, “Plague. No Plague dragons.”
Genjiwei cleared his throat.
Diath lowered his head, slowly shook it, then looked up. “You are different my friend.”
“And Qen isn’t?” Sonnet still fuming. “I should have more of a problem with him being Plague than you.”
The room went silent. It was well know that she had allowed herself to be exalted do to grief in finding out her first born was force exalted to the Plaguebringer - unnamed. She had been allowed to return by the Gladekeeper.
“May I speak?” Qen’s quiet but projected bass voice broke the stillness. Diath started to answer. But, looked at Calysta who slightly nodded. He grunted his permission.
“It’s true I was born in a Plague nest. But, both of my parents were of Ice and were exalted to the Icewarden and Windsinger. I was raised in a Shadow clan and all of my offspring were of Shadow. I consider myself Shadow Flight. I will never do harm to this clan.”
All eyes fell on to Diath. Calysta moved closer and gently rolled her pearl along his tense neck muscles. He sighed. “Fine, but there is no more room at Tareesh.”
Sonnet rolled her eyes. But before she could respond, Cimmeron spoke. “Zorast will accept him brother.”
Diath looked over to her and nodded once. He turned and left.
Qen is now Cohortes Urbanae at Zorast. He and Rylla have become a couple. Her Ichor Nymph has befriended him also.
